02 · Context and business problem

Why the problem mattered.

Automation depends on complete, consistent, timely, and understandable data. When source quality degrades, user trust and operational performance follow.

Business problem

What had to change

The product needed more than a quality score. Teams needed clear documentation, owners, thresholds, exception workflows, and a review rhythm.

10 · Delivery and rollout

Connect discovery to release readiness.

Introduced data-quality, documentation, and review practices within the product workflow. Delivery linked product rules to user stories, measurable acceptance criteria, UAT scenarios, operational readiness and post-launch monitoring.
